I saw this in one of those trader mags

1969 Chevrolet Nova SS L78
19K actual miles, #’s matching L78 396/375, 4-speed, 12 bolt rear axle, smog, power front disc brakes, bench seat, red-line tires, mostly original paint, Frost Lime Green, original interior and comes with original build sheet. Very desirable and irreplaceable muscle car!

$69,500

Here ya go. She kept a note book of everything she ever did to the car, from tune ups to oil changes and any service she ever did. I have a huge pile of service records witch date back to 1970. She repainted it once in I think it was 1981, and recovered the seats and put a cloth insert. She said she did it because the viynal was to hot on her back in summer time. The car only had 3000 miles put on it since 1985. She said it just was to hot to drive as she got older, needed air she said. She bought it when she was 23. But as a I stated I have paper work showing all the work. Kinda cool, to bad it was not a L48 or L78 O WELL.
